Take High-Quality Pictures

How to Sell Your Designer Handbag Online for Cash: Reseller Checklist

In the times of YouTube and Instagram, the quality of visual content is extremely important. Blurry or dark photos will hardly attract potential customers. Moreover, the photos should serve as a proof of the authenticity of a handbag. So it is crucial to take photos of all the small details that can give away a fake - hardware, heat stamp, serial number or date code, all the engravings and embossing. 

Potential buyers will ask for these photos anyway, so you will just save time if you do it before listing the item, and this way you will reassure your potential customer that you have nothing to hide. Moreover, if you are selling a handbag for $2,000, and there are just 4 pictures of it in the listing, it just looks unprofessional. 

 

 

Document All the Wear and Tear

How to Sell Your Designer Handbag Online for Cash: Reseller Checklist

Keep in mind that your photos should show the actual condition of the item, do not sugar coat the pictures - buyers need to understand what they are purchasing. Customers are different - some have been on the second-hand market for years, others are buying pre-loved for the first time. 

Moreover, it is very important to add a description listing all the wear and tear in case a customer misses something looking through the pics briefly. It is the biggest dilemma - you need to give the most true-to-life description but in a way that it is still marketable. 

 

 

Avoid These Mistakes: Handbag Description Checklist

How to Sell Your Designer Handbag Online for Cash: Reseller Checklist

I have been in reseller business for quite a long time, and I have noticed some mistakes in the listings that slow down sales. So, here are the things you definitely need to mention in your description that customers pay attention to:

 

  • Handbag Measurements

You don’t need to actually measure the bag, just look it up on the website.

 

  • Name of the Handbag

Customers may want to look the bag up and compare it with other listings. Moreover, luxury bag lovers may be looking for that particular model, so you raise the chances of selling the bag as the name will definitely show up in the search. 

 

  • Condition Rank

The condition should be defined compared to a new purse. Don't try to make your wear and tear list as extensive as possible. However, there is another extreme - some sellers just state that the condition is pristine, but looking at the photos it becomes obvious that it certainly isn't. It is one of the common mistakes.

Make sure to mention how the bag looks like, what impression it gives (looks worn or not), if there is some shape loss, etc. Sometimes a bag that has been used for long looks very good as it has been taken good care of, and a bag that has been worn just a couple of times but has been stored incorrectly looks awful.   • Main Defects

It is better to list the main defects an item has - canvas/leather, glazing, hardware issues - in order to avoid future returns and refunds that you’ll definitely face in this case. Always make a note that the pictures show the wear and tear better and that the item is pre-loved, not new. 

 

  • Initials or Other Customization

Not all customers are happy to receive a bag and find initials that don’t have anything to do with their first or last name, so, please, be sure to mention it in the description.   • Mention Odors

It can be a decisive factor for many customers, as sometimes people can’t stand the smell of cigarettes or can simply be allergic. 

 

  • If the Handbag Has Been Repaired

This can be a very important thing for purses of some luxury brands. For example, Louis Vuitton or Hermes warranty immediately expires if their bags have been repaired by a local cobbler. 

And you should definitely mention if the bag has been fully repainted. With time, it will show, the paint will start to fade and crack, and you will need to repaint it over and over. Such purses should be listed at a discounted price. 

 

  • Set: What the Purse Comes With

Not all the customers know what a certain purse should come with and can assume different things, so it is very important to mention if the bag comes with a receipt, a box, a dustbag, an authenticity card, a strap, a pouch (often asked about Louis Vuitton Neverfull), a clochette, a lock, a set of keys. 

 

 

How Much Can I Sell My Designer Purse For?

Setting the price right can be tricky, there is always this problem of asking too much and get no customers, or asking too little and make no money. My advice is to do market research and look up how much consignment shops, second-hand platforms and resellers usually charge for the item you are about to sell, depending on condition. 

As we have already mentioned in our guide on How To Clean Out Your Designer Closet and Make Extra Cash, experts advise to price your used clothing at half of their original cost, if they are relatively new and in great condition. Ask for 25% of the current retail price for anything that has been in your closet for several years, and 10% for everything else.

But keep in mind that there are bags that are always in high demand, no matter their age, like, for example, Hermes Birkins or Chanel classic flaps. That means that they are sought after, and you can set a slightly higher price and won’t wait long for someone to snatch it. 

Another important thing to mention is to always make room for discount, online customers tend to ask for it. 

And the last but not least in our reseller checklist of How to Sell Your Designer Handbag Online for Cash, when listing your purse, don’t forget to indicate the retail price. The amount of money saved compared to buying new bags is why people turn to the pre-loved market. But it is better to state the real price, do not exaggerate, it can have the opposite effect of putting a customer off, especially if they have been on the market long. And, to be honest, it looks suspicious.
